Symptoms
Symptoms of a spinal cord injury may include:
- Head that is in an unusual position
- Numbness or tingling that spreads down an arm or leg
- Weakness
- Difficulty walking
-
Paralysis (loss of movement) of arms or legs - No bladder or bowel control
-
Shock (pale, clammy skin; bluish lips and fingernails; acting dazed or semiconscious) - Lack of alertness (unconsciousness)
- Stiff neck, headache, or neck pain
